feat: add test suite, fix backend bugs, remove legacy artifacts 🧪
- Add 73-test suite across conftest, utils, admin API, reconciler, zone parser, and CoreDNS MySQL backend (all green, ~0.5s) - Fix zone_exists filter using wrong column name (name → zone_name) - Fix delete_zone missing dot_fqdn normalization on lookup - Remove spurious unused `from config import config` in coredns_mysql.py - Fix config loader to search module-relative path so tests find app.yml without needing a root-level config/ directory - Remove legacy v1 Flask prototype (app.py), empty config.json, and duplicate root config/app.yml
